Vantaggi

+ The company culture is great; we have annual retreats, company outings, a pool table, an arcade machine, company lunch, etc. The people I work with all take interest in what they're working on and helping the team do well. + The CEO, DongSoo, is the hardest worker in the office and a genuinely good guy. He seems to pursue well-thought-out, intimate client engagements that focus on building relationships that leave both the client and Raybeam engineers in a better place than when the project began. + The projects tend to be short (up to several year) engagements, allowing Raybeam engineers to start from scratch with new technologies every so often. Both East and West coast project managers (Wes and DongSoo) are very responsive when an engineer is unhappy with their current workload/project. + Raybeam Engineers are Consultants, meaning we work directly with clients to gather requirements, build expectations, and deliver on those expectations. That gives us a lot of agency in what we do, and a lot of exposure to different companies, work styles, and people. + While the company structure is flat, Raybeam has been extremely generous with year end bonuses and raises to keep up with employee experience.

Svantaggi

- Because it's consulting, it's dynamic work. Potential applicants should consider that they'll be put in front of clients with changing requirements and have to manage those expectations. The project managers would never throw someone off the deep end, but after a few months expect to be able to face a client. - For people looking to advance up a corporate ladder, there isn't one here. You will, however, gain exposure with clients at high profile tech companies.
